What is risk management?
Risk Management Refers to the process of identifying, Evaluating and aleviating possibly losses or threats, which may affect the trader’s portfolio or investment. During the cryptocurrency trade, risk management involves determining the restrictions of positions, monitoring market conditions and adjusting trading strategies.

Best Exercises for Risk Management in the Trading Link (Link)
In order to treat the risk effectively, consider the following Proven Exercises during Chainlink’s Trade:
- Set clear risk management goals : determine what you want to achieve with trade, either to maximize profit or to Maintain Capital.
- Use positional dimensioning strategies : Age exposure to a particular device by defining the size restriction of each trade.
- Monitor Market Conditions : Monitor Basic and Technical Analysis Indicators, Market Emotions and News Developments.
- Complete Stop-Loss Orders : Set Stop-Loss Orders To Limit Possible Losses If You Fall Low A Certain Level.
- Use risk-right ratios : calculate the expected reward ratio of each trade to ensure that you do not take capital or unnecessary risk.
